Tribal man wins ₹12-crore bumper lottery

Feb 12, 2020 4:46 PM, 4 news, 2 views

A day after the draw of the Kerala Christmas New Year Bumper lottery of the State government, the winner of the first prize, which is a whopping ₹12 crore, has been identified: 52-year-old Porunnan Rajan, a member of the Kurichiya community and a…
